The Role: As our Thanet Deputy Manager 32 hours you will lead and inspire a team to deliver great results through your commerciality, collaboration, resilience and being customer obsessed. You'll have the opportunity to make a significant impact on our customers' shopping experience. Take the reins, inspire a team of fashion enthusiasts, and create an unforgettable shopping journey. In your high street store, you will lead your team to create a customer obsessed atmosphere. You will be genuine in your delivery of a shopping experience that helps our customers express their individuality, personality and unique style through fashion. You will create and lead a team who support one another and deliver results whilst having fun along the way! You will be fully accountable for your store performance, by working alongside your Territory Leader to continually identify opportunities which will impact KPI's, customer service, team development and overall sales.

About you:

  • You have previous store/deputy management experience
  • You have a track record of effectively leading and managing a team
  • You identify yourself as a New Look brand adorer
  • You have a history of delivering and exceeding KPI's and key objectives
  • Commercial acumen
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to engage with customers and provide exceptional service.
  • Exceptional organizational skills to handle inventory management, stock control, and order replenishment efficiently.

WHATS IN IT FOR YOU:

  • 40% staff discount plus friends & family discounts throughout the year
  • Access to our reward platform for external discount and offers
  • Private pension scheme
  • Option to join our Healthcare Private Medical Scheme
  • Virtual GP access for you and your children
  • All employees are covered by our life assurance policy from day one
  • Enhanced maternity, paternity and adoption leave, and shared parental leave (eligible after 2 years service)
  • Cycle2Work scheme

How to prepare for a job interview at New Look

Know Your Brand

Before the interview, dive deep into the New Look brand. Understand its values, mission, and what makes it unique in the fashion industry. This will not only show your passion but also help you align your answers with the company's ethos.

Showcase Your Leadership Skills

Prepare examples from your previous experience where you've successfully led a team. Highlight how you inspired them to achieve results, especially in a retail environment. Use specific metrics or KPIs to demonstrate your impact.

Customer Obsession is Key

Be ready to discuss how you prioritise customer experience. Share stories that illustrate your commitment to creating a customer-obsessed atmosphere and how you've gone above and beyond to meet their needs.

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few thoughtful questions prepared. Inquire about team dynamics, store performance goals, or how they measure success.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it's the right fit for you.
